A U Tube Manometer is a simple yet highly accurate instrument used to measure pressure, vacuum, and differential pressure in various industrial and laboratory applications. It consists of a transparent U-shaped tube partially filled with a manometric fluid such as mercury, water, or colored oil. The pressure difference between two points causes the liquid column to rise or fall, allowing precise measurement based on the height difference. U tube manometers are widely used in HVAC systems, gas lines, chemical plants, laboratories, and research facilities. They are especially effective for low-pressure measurements where high sensitivity and accuracy are required. Since the device operates without complex mechanical parts, it offers reliable performance, minimal maintenance, and long service life. The working principle of a U tube manometer is based on hydrostatic pressure. When pressure is applied to one side of the tube, the liquid level shifts until equilibrium is achieved. The difference in liquid height corresponds directly to the applied pressure, which can be calculated using standard formulas. Due to this straightforward mechanism, U tube manometers provide highly accurate readings without the need for external power sources. These manometers are commonly constructed using durable materials such as glass, acrylic, or polycarbonate for the tube, with a sturdy metal or plastic scale for easy reading. They are available in wall-mounted and portable designs, depending on the application requirements. Compared to advanced digital pressure gauges, U tube manometers are cost-effective and ideal for calibration, testing, and educational purposes. They are also commonly used to verify readings from pressure transmitters and gauges in industrial setups. When selecting a U tube manometer, factors such as pressure range, type of manometric fluid, scale graduation, and environmental conditions should be considered. Overall, the U tube manometer remains a dependable and economical solution for accurate pressure measurement across various industries.
